Howzzat, A Book On Cricket Scandals

Viveck Shettyy, Managing Director, Indus Communications, took centre stage for the 'Howzzat' book reading as a highly enthusiastic audience listened with rapt attention. He further went on to moderate the discussion and the question and answer session with great elan and finesse and a very sharp sense of humour.
Mani Dmello and Sanjay Pandey took on all questions, some extremely tricky ones at that. Madhusudan Kumar and Viren Shah also actively participated in the discussions and deliberations. Viveck Shettyy finally announced, “We have fixed the tea break now and hopefully somebody will soon come up and pay us for fixing it" and had the audience in splits.
The grapevine reveals that some Bollywood producers are looking at the Howzzat very seriously as a possible script for their next film. Meanwhile the debutante authors gear up to launch their next book focused on the 2G scam. Well, by the time the book comes out, there might be a 3G scam. Howzzat?
